    Quote Originally Posted by gimp View Post
    Looks pretty good. So that's the Katod? What tube specs?
    Thats the lower end tube FOM min1260 (SOLD) but from memory it measured 1451FOM , lp/mm61 , S/N23.8 ,gain 55`000x. They go in 3 grades FOM 1260 min , FOM 1600 min , FOM 1800 min. Have one arriving this morning in FOM1260min.
    I had been invited to do a Demo in Timaru area so had the Katod with me. 4 sets of PVS-7`s was a bit of overkill.
    As you know Gimp I have had a bit to do with this stuff and it takes a bit to impress me after the U.S gear. I wouldn`t bring it in if I wouldn`t be happy useing it myself. The FOM1260 makes the XR5 tubes look pretty sick @ about half the price.
